#648b20 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#648b20 is composed of 39.2% red, 54.5%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 77%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 81.9 degrees, a saturation of 62.6% and a lightness of 33.5%. #648b20 color hex could be obtained by blending #c8ff40 with #001700.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

#648b20 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#648b20 has RGB values of R:100, G:139, B:32 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0, Y:0.77,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 6589216.

Shades and Tints of #648b20
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080b03 is the darkest color, while #fdfefa is the lightest one.

Tones of #648b20
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#565655 is the less saturated color, while #6ba506 is the most saturated one.
